Previous forecasts indicated that Cyprus's GDP for the first quarter of this year might be 1.6%. In the fourth quarter of 2014, the GDP growth rate was -0.4%. The Statistical Service of Cyprus stated that the positive economic growth in the first quarter of this year ended the country's difficult period of 14 consecutive quarters of negative growth. Data released by the Statistical Service of Cyprus shows that sectors including hotels, trade, restaurants, electricity, and communications all exhibited positive growth.
